Cover-up comin' back

Bookmark and Share

Ever since the demise of Kings last year, one of many voids around here has been the annual "Great Cover-Up." It used to be one of the best regular shindigs ever, Halloween for the local music community. Bands would play tribute sets, going to amazing lengths to recreate (or radically deconstruct) the sound and even look of everybody from Danzig to Small Faces.

Cover-Up has been dormant since Kings closed, but it's coming back. Christopher Black Tamplin over at downtown Raleigh nightspot Tir Na Nog is reviving Cover-Up Jan. 30-Feb. 1 with the same basic format as the Kings Cover-Ups, meaning that bands and tribute subjects will not be announced in advance.
